Handover — Brel to Oskane, fan-out backpressure.

Current state: Drumline dispatcher sheds load at 80% queue depth; consumers on the Veldt cluster still lag under burst. My branch adds token-bucket pacing per topic — review the shed-order change carefully, it alters retry semantics. Staging config is locked behind the emergency vault since last week's incident. Vault recovery passphrase follows below.

recovery phrase for fawif-tajeg: norael-aldmir-casir-brivan-ulaion

## Deploying the Gatewick Proctor Queue

Deploys are pretty painless: push to main, wait for the pipeline, then watch the queue drain dashboard for five minutes. If candidates pile up mid-exam, roll back first and ask questions later — the queue replays safely. Everything the workers care about lives in one config block, shown here for reference.

settings of bafof-yagef:
JOROX_PIN=8740
JOROX_TENANT=pelox
JOROX_METRICS_HOST=metrics.jorox.qorvelworks.internal
JOROX_SEAL=seal_c78f63c1
JOROX_STANDBY_TEAM=norax

To: All Branch Managers

Next month we introduce Skylark Plus, a mid-level subscription sitting between Basic and Premier. It includes priority scheduling, two additional seats, and quarterly account reviews. Pricing lands 22% above Basic. Branches should train front-desk staff before launch week and update signage per the Dellhaven playbook. Do not discuss the tier with customers until the public announcement. Early enrollment targets will be circulated separately. Strategic context, confidential, appears below.

confidential, kagup-bafog: Fraaxax Group is in early talks to buy Soroxox Group for about $343.8 million. The Olidor launch date is June 14, and nothing goes to the press before then. Legal wants the Aldmirek Logistics term sheet signed before July 23.

[ ] Catalog cache invalidation — Ferncart. Confirm plugin-issued invalidation hooks fire on price and SKU updates; stale variants persisted 6h in last release. Plugins must call the invalidate endpoint with the full product key, not the slug. Partial keys silently no-op. Test against the staging catalog with at least one bundled product. Record results and attach the build token shown below.

session token of bawep-yadup = htk21_528abd376e3c5a4ec24a1